Devotional for November 14th God’s call to preach. Today we continue in 1 Corinthians chapter 9. 16 For when I preach the gospel, I cannot boast, since I am compelled to preach. Woe to me if I do not preach the gospel! 17 If I preach voluntarily, I have a reward; if not voluntarily, I am simply discharging the trust committed to me. 18 What then is my reward? Just this: that in preaching the gospel I may offer it free of charge, and so not make full use of my rights as a preacher of the gospel. Remember the past two days devotionals. Paul has given the reason for his authority, and that, if he wished, he would be deserving of wages from the Corinthians. Now Paul becomes a little transparent. He makes clear that the Lord has given him the duty of spreading the Gospel of Jesus, and teaching and building up Christians. It is the furtherance of the Gospel that is most important to Paul. He simply says that gaining souls for the Kingdom of God is more important that the rights he might personally exercise. So, what does this mean to you and I? We are given the same charge to spread the Gospel. We may not be a preacher or a teacher, but we have been given the same responsibility. We must tell our friends and acquaintances about the Christ who can take away their sin and has done so much in our lives. I want to stress, this is not just for the person who “works for the church” or the “outgoing person.” This is the duty and call of every Believer. We must reach those around us for Christ. That is the trust that has been committed to us. Why do we find it so difficult to talk to others about Christ? Who can you talk to today about the Lord and their need?
